ACER, ACEO, ACIDUM, to be or to make sour, tart
ACETABULUM, a “vinegar” cruet: a small measure, equivalent to 15 Attic drachms; see [Measures]
ACETUM, vinegar
—— MULSUM, mead
ACICULA, ACUS, the needle fish, or horn-back, or horn-beak; a long fish with a snout sharp like a needle; the gar-fish, or sea-needle
ACIDUM, sour; same as [ACER]
ACINATICIUS, a costly raisin wine
ACINOSUS, full of kernels or stones
ACINUS, —UM, a grain, or grape raisin berry or kernel
ACIPENSER, a large fish, sturgeon, ℞ [145]; also see [STYRIO]
ACOR, —UM, sourness, tartness; the herb sweetcane, gardenflag, galangale
